HR 1824 · 95th Congress · Government Operations and Politics

A bill to designate the birthday of Martin Luther King, Jr., as a legal public holiday.

Introduced 1977-01-13· Sponsored by Del. Fauntroy, Walter E. [D-DC-At Large]· House
